    Team Description:

  • The Commercial Finance team provides all aspects of financial support in order to achieve our business goals and objectives, analysis of our financial performance and support for all financial decision making in the business, including:


  • o Budgeting and forecasting of Sales, Good Causes, Gross Margin, Operating costs and Cash flow

    o Decision support, particularly through the development of financial business cases to support our commercial proposals

    o Safeguarding our financial assets through control processes and ensuring that scarce resources are spent wisely

    o Publication of our Financial results to our Executive team and the Board

    o Day to day cost control / Management accounts reporting

    o Ad hoc financial analysis,

    We are Allwyn UK, part of the Allwyn Entertainment Group - a multi-national lottery operator with a market-leading presence in Austria, the Czech Republic, Greece, Cyprus and Italy. We have been officially awarded the Fourth Licence (10 year licence) to operate the National Lottery starting February 2024.
